Susquehanna International Group (SIG), founded in 1987 by Jeff Yass and a group of friends, is a privately held global quantitative trading and technology firm headquartered in Bala Cynwyd, Pennsylvania. Specializing in trading equities, fixed income, commodities, derivatives, and ETFs, SIG has grown into a major market maker, handling around 600 equity options and 45 index options across exchanges like the CBOE, while employing over 3,000 people worldwide. The firm leverages a data-driven, probabilistic approach—rooted in the founders’ poker-playing days—to provide liquidity and competitive pricing in financial markets, with additional ventures in private equity, venture capital (notably an early investment in ByteDance, TikTok’s parent company), and sports betting analytics. Known for its innovative culture and use of game theory, SIG operates offices across North America, Europe, Asia, and Australia, maintaining a low-profile yet influential presence in global finance.

Susquehanna International Group's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, Susquehanna International Group held 14,936 positions worth $387B, down 4.3% from $404B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 32% of the portfolio.

Susquehanna International Group's Q3 2022 filing shows 2,167 new, 5,455 increased, 5,274 reduced and 1,852 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Vanguard Short-Term Corporate Bond ETF: 714,572 shares worth $53.1M. The largest sale was Tesla, an estimated $799M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 1.9% of assets, up from 1.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Communication Services.
